Driving experience
Getting behind the wheel of the 147 is an experience that awakens the senses. The JTD engine pushes with a powerful force from low revs, thanks to its 305 Nm of torque, launching you forward with an energy that pins you to the seat. It's not just the acceleration, it's how it feels. The steering is quick and communicative, and the chassis, with its elaborate suspension, invites you to link curves with an agility and confidence that are captivating. Every journey becomes a small adventure, a reminder of why we love to drive.

Technology and features
Under its designer skin, the 147 hid remarkable technology for its time. The heart of this version, the 1.9 JTD engine, was a gem of diesel engineering, with common-rail injection, a variable geometry turbo, and 16 valves to deliver 150 horsepower with excellent response and refinement. Beyond the engine, its advanced double-wishbone front suspension, an almost race-car-like solution, made a clear difference in dynamic behavior compared to most of its competitors.
Competition
In the competitive arena of premium compacts, the Alfa 147 faced giants like the BMW 1 Series, the Audi A3, and the Volkswagen Golf. While its German rivals played the cards of construction perfection, sobriety, and practicality, the Alfa Romeo offered something different: a Latin soul. It was the passionate alternative, the car for those who valued design above all else and sought a more intimate and emotional connection with the machine.
